Successful car accident claims are built on solid evidence. Before you’re able to recover compensation for the losses you suffered as a result of the crash, you’ll need to prove to the at-fault party or their insurance provider that you were not responsible. When you demonstrate that another driver was liable for the accident, you can hold them financially accountable for the damages they caused.
Without evidence, insurance adjusters are forced to rely on your word versus the word of the other driver when they investigate an accident. Reliable proof of the factors that led to the accident, however, can show that someone else’s negligence caused the collision.
In many cases, witness statements are important pieces of evidence that speak to the facts of a car accident in ways that photographs or reports cannot. A credible witness can offer an unbiased account of the events that occurred before, during, and after the wreck. With the help of a witness’s statement, investigators can reconstruct a collision and determine the most likely causes of the crash.
It’s likely that you will be shaken and disoriented after a motor vehicle collision, and possibly injured. Nevertheless, it’s in your best interest to begin identifying and communicating with witnesses once you determine that you’re in no immediate danger.
Tracking down witnesses after the accident scene has been cleared is much more challenging, so doing what you can in the moments after the wreck can make the claims process easier for you and your lawyer.

In some cases, it may seem like no one was there to witness your accident except yourself, the other driver, and any passengers along for the ride. Passengers are not usually the most reliable witnesses in a car accident claim because they are often friends or family members of the drivers. While passenger statements are important, they’re much more likely to be biased.

Even if other people did witness the accident, their statements will only be valuable evidence for your claim if they are considered credible witnesses. A credible witness is usually someone who was not involved in the crash, has no stake in the outcome of your claim, and can be relied upon to make truthful statements.
